Skip to main content
Version: Next

Tạo tài khoản ảo

API: POST /v1/bank/create-va

Tạo mới tài khoản ảo (Virtual Account) cho Merchant, cho phép nhận thông báo biến động số dư.

Cách sử dụng

const result = await client.bank.createVa({
accountType: 'personal-account',
bankBin: '970418',
accountNumber: '0935926988',
accountName: 'NGUYEN THI HUYEN',
identity: '040191014068',
mobile: '0123456789',
});

Tham số đầu vào

TrườngKiểuBắt buộcMô tả
accountTypestringLoại tài khoản: personal-account, business-account, business-household-account
bankBinstringMã BIN ngân hàng. Dùng BankBinEnum
accountNumberstringSố tài khoản ngân hàng muốn liên kết
accountNamestringTên chủ tài khoản
identitystringCMND/CCCD hoặc Mã số thuế
mobilestringSố điện thoại đăng ký
merchantIdnumberID Merchant (bắt buộc nếu qua Master Merchant)
isNotifyAccountNumberbooleantrue để liên kết STK gốc, mặc định false (tạo STK ảo)

Response

{
"code": "00",
"message": "Success",
"data": {
"confirmId": "886b05e9-2d94-4b41-9839-138c941fd1d9"
}
}
TrườngKiểuMô tả
data.confirmIdstringMã xác thực cần dùng cho bước confirmVa